Posted by Mike Florio on December 21, 2008, 1:04 p.m.

If you had 13 days in the “How long will it take Pacman Jones to get himself in trouble with the league again?” pool, you might be a winner.

Two full weeks after Jones was reinstated after his second suspension in less than two years, there’s a rumor coming out of Dallas in the wake of Saturday night’s crushing loss by the Cowboys to the Ravens that cornerback Pacman Jones was “back to his old self” at a Dallas-area night club.

By “old self,” we don’t mean that he was getting arrested or breaking any laws or instigating violence. But given his history it’s going to take far less than any of that to get him permanently ejected from the NFL.
